Time Out Market Cape Town opens brand new wine bar!

Cultivar Wine Bar offers a one-stop discovery of the Cape Winelands.

Time Out Market Cape Town has unveiled a brand new boutique wine offering.

Cultivar Wine Bar offers a uniquely curated wine experience showcasing the quality and diversity of South Africa’s wine regions. In step with the world-class culinary experience served up by the Market’s 13 chefs, Cultivar Wine Bar will pour a world-class taste of the country’s winemaking excellence.

‘Having recently celebrated our first anniversary, we are thrilled to introduce Cultivar to our curated lineup,’ says Russ Meyer, General Manager of Time Out Market Cape Town. ‘This exciting addition not only complements the food the Market offers from the city’s best chefs and restaurateurs but also reinforces our commitment to supporting and showcasing the exceptional talent of local winemakers.’

At Cultivar Wine Bar, trained wine stewards are committed to sharing their knowledge with guests of all experience levels, making the world of wine approachable, educational, and enjoyable.

At the Bar, guests will find a thoughtfully curated list of South African wines, including limited-edition wines. With more than 120 bottles on offer, the wine list also includes a wide selection available by the glass. That includes a selection of premium wines – don't miss the Restless River Ava Marie Chardonnay – by the glass, offering guests a chance to try rare and high-end releases without committing to a full bottle.

Cultivar caters to everyone from hungry diners to wine aficionados, with sommelier-led tasting flights that explore the nuances of South African terroir. Guests can sample a variety of wines from across the Cape, and choose from tasting experiences tailored to their preferences.
